Tofa Fatialofa MomoШаблон:Okinae (13 March 1923 – 29 December 1980) was a Western Samoan politician. He served as a member of the Legislative Assembly from 1967 until his death, and as Minister for the Post Office, Radio and Broadcasting from 1970 to 1971.

Biography

During his youth MomoШаблон:Okinae was a successful boxer.[1] He was elected to the Legislative Assembly in 1967, unseating incumbent MLA Auelua Filipo.[2] After being re-elected in 1970 he was appointed Minister for the Post Office, Radio and Broadcasting in the new government. However, he resigned from the cabinet the following year.[3]

He was re-elected to the Legislative Assembly again in 1973, 1976 and 1979.[2] He died in December 1980 during a visit to Honolulu to see the son of a friend ordained as a priest.[4]
